MODULE #5: FUNCTIONAL PERFOMANCE OF BALL MILLING

If a ball mill contained only coarse particles, then of the mill grinding volume and power draw would be applied to the grinding of coarse particles. In reality, the mill always contains fines: these fines are present in the ball mill feed and are produced as the particles pass through the mill.

Condition monitoring on ball mill - SPM Instrument

Ball mills are a low-speed application (typical rotational speed is 10-20 RPM), where bearing damage can be challenging to detect. Condition monitoring of the ball mill began in December 2016 and right from the start, the readings indicated potential damage on the output main bearing. Monitoring the fill level of a ball mill using vibration ...

Ball mills are extensively used in the size reduction process of different ores and minerals. The fill level inside a ball mill is a crucial parameter which needs to be monitored regularly for optimal operation of the ball mill. In this paper, a vibration monitoring-based method is proposed and tested for estimating the fill level inside a laboratory-scale ball mill. A vibration signal is ...

Mixer Mill MM 500 control - Dry, wet and cryogenic ...

Mixer Mill MM 500 control. The MM 500 control is a high energy laboratory ball mill that can be used for dry, wet and cryogenic grinding with a frequency of up to 30 Hz. It is the first mixer mill in the market that allows to monitor and control the temperature of a grinding process. The temperature area covers a range from – 100 to 100 °C.

The automatic control system (ACS) of the ball mill's load.

The ACS BM (ACS) is designed to provide centralized monitoring and automatic process control of coal grinding in ball mills at the normal technological process, as well as at start and stop conditions (routine and emergency) of the boilers of the thermal power plants based on coal.

3D Blast Movement Monitoring | BMT

Pine Cove mine, located on the Newfoundland coast (Canada), was experiencing 20% dilution and lower mill feed grades because blast movement was entirely displacing ore blocks. By implementing blast monitoring, Anaconda reduced dilution to 5%, increased the mill grade and limited the waste going to the mill—generating $15,000 to $30,000 per blast.
